Is it legal for members of Congress to trade Apple Inc.?

Yes. Under the 2012 STOCK Act, members of Congress may buy and sell individual stocks but must publicly disclose each transaction within 45 days. Bargo surfaces those filings so you can see who traded AAPL and how it performed.
